Draught @ Élesztő, Tűzoltó utca 22., Budapest, Hungary 1094. [ As Horizont Gentle Bastard IPA ].Unclear medium amber orange colour with a average,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white to white head. Aroma is moderate malty, pale malt, caramel, fruity malt, moderate to light light heavy hoppy, citrus, fruity hops. Flavor is moderate sweet and bitter with a average duration, fruity hops, fruity, fruity malt, sweet malt, hoppy and malty. Body is medium,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is soft. hazy orange to amber colour, medium sized, quickly collapsing off-white head; aroma of floral honey, tropical fruity and citrusy, slight celery, as well as some resiny notes; bittersweet taste with resiny, honey, tropical fruity and citrusy notes; good IPA

Bottled 330ml. -from Svijet Piva Zagreb. Dark orange/golden coloured, medium sized white to off-white head, mild lemon and orange in the nose. Sweet malty, light caramel, mild citrusy hoppy and bitter sweet finish. Touch of alcohol as well.

Keg at Neked Csak Dezső, Budapest, 08/06/18. Lightly hazed golden orange with a decent off white covering. Nose is juicy citric peel, melon, tangerine, melon, light pine. Taste comprises orange pith, cantaloupe melon, mango, soft breads, light pine. Medium bodied, fine carbonation, semi drying close splashed with juicy hop bitterness. Decent IPA.

330mL bottle, pours a cloudy dark orange with a small white head. Aroma brings out orange rinds, citrus hops and caramel biscuity malt. Flavour is overmalted, with sweet candied sugar, caramel, and medicinal notes. Barely any hops in here. Not good.

Bottle (thanks Tamás)! Batch 111. Amber body, white head. Huh... the aroma is too sweet, crystal malt, peachy and lemony notes. Sweetish, mainly malty taste, slightly cream, vague traces of hops, ending in a solid nice bitterness. Not that bad, just... needs tweaking.
